Ingredients for the Perfect Creamy Bowtie Pasta

The beauty of this dish lies in its simple ingredients that come together to create something extraordinary.

Chicken and Pasta

Choose boneless, skinless chicken breast or thighs for the best results. Thighs stay juicy and flavorful even after cooking. Bowtie pasta, also called farfalle, is ideal because its shape holds onto the sauce beautifully.

Garlic Butter Base

Butter forms the heart of the sauce, giving it richness and depth. Garlic adds a fragrant, savory flavor that makes the dish irresistible.

Cheesy Cream Sauce

You will need heavy cream for a silky texture and a mix of mozzarella and parmesan cheese to create the perfect creamy sauce. Mozzarella melts into gooey perfection, while parmesan adds a salty, nutty kick.

Seasonings and Add-Ins

Italian seasoning, salt, pepper, and a pinch of red pepper flakes provide a balanced flavor profile. If you want to add more nutrition, toss in baby spinach, cherry tomatoes, or sliced mushrooms near the end of cooking.

How to Make Mozzarella Garlic Butter Chicken Bowties

Follow these simple steps to create your new favorite weeknight dinner.

Step 1: Cook the Pasta

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il and cook your bowtie pasta until al dente. Reserve about half a cup of the pasta water before draining, as you may need it to adjust the sauce later.

Step 2: Cook the Chicken

Season your chicken pieces with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at, melt a little butter, and sauté the chicken until golden brown and cooked through. Remove from the skillet and set aside.

Step 3: Prepare the Garlic Butter Sauce

In the same skillet, melt more butter and add the minced garlic. Cook just until fragrant, being careful not to let it burn.

Step 4: Make the Cheesy Cream

Pour in the heavy cream and bring it to a gentle simmer. Stir in the mozzarella and parmesan until melted and smooth.

Step 5: Combine Everything

Return the chicken to the skillet and toss in the cooked pasta. Stir until everything is coated in the sauce. If it feels too thick, add a splash of the reserved pasta water until you reach your desired consistency.

Tips for Perfect Results

  • Always use freshly grated cheese, as it melts much better than pre-shredded

  • Do not overcook the pasta, since it will absorb more sauce as it sits

  • Taste the sauce before serving and adjust the seasoning if needed

  • Add fresh herbs like parsley or basil at the end to brighten the flavors

Make-Ahead, Storage, and Reheating

This recipe is great for meal prep or leftovers.

  • Make-ahead: You can cook the chicken and prepare the sauce ahead of time. When ready to serve, reheat and toss with freshly cooked pasta.

  • Storage: Keep le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days.

  • Reheating: Warm gently on the stove over low heat, adding a splash of milk or cream to bring back the creamy texture.

Frequently Asked Questions About Mozzarella Garlic Butter Chicken Bowties

Can I use a different type of pasta?

Yes, penne, rigatoni, or fusilli all work well and hold onto the sauce nicely.

Can I make this recipe lighter?

You can substitute half-and-half for heavy cream and reduce the cheese slightly for a lighter version.

Can I add vegetables to this dish?

Absolutely. Spinach, mushrooms, peas, or cherry tomatoes are great additions.

Can I make this recipe ahead for meal prep?

Yes. Just keep the pasta and sauce separate and combine them right before eating to prevent the pasta from soaking up all the sauce.

This Mozzarella Garlic Butter Chicken Bowties in Cheesy Cream is a rich and comforting pasta dish loaded with tender chicken, buttery garlic, and melted mozzarella in a creamy sauce. Perfect for a cozy dinner, it’s an easy and indulgent meal that comes together in under 45 minutes.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ine American, Italian
Servings 6 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 12 oz bowtie pasta farfalle
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 lb bo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 4 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es optional
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ley chopped (for garnish)

Instructions
 

  • Cook bowtie pasta according to package directions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  • In a large skillet, heat butter and olive oil over medium heat. Season chicken with salt and pepper, then cook until golden and cooked through. Remove and set aside.
  • In the same skillet, sauté garlic until fragrant.
  • Pour in chicken broth and heavy cream. Simmer until slightly thickened.
  • Stir in mozzarella and Parmesan until melted and smooth.
  • Add Italian seasoning and red pepper flakes, if using.
  • Return chicken and pasta to the skillet, tossing to coat everything in the sauce.
  •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.

Notes

  • Add sautéed spinach, mushrooms, or sun-dried tomatoes for variation.
  • Substitute mozzarella with provolone, gouda, or a cheese blend for a different flavor.
  • For a lighter version, use half cream and half milk.
  • Whole wheat or gluten-free pasta works well too.
  • Store leftovers in the fridge for up to 4 days and reheat with a splash of milk or cream to loosen the sauce.
